Missoula Children’s Theatre proudly presents an original musical adaptation of the Brothers Grimm’s age-old tale of a journey, a secret, and a grand adventure. Left behind while their friends embark on summer adventures, Hank and Gretchen are stuck with a severe case of the summertime blues. But boredom quickly morphs into bewilderment when they drift into a shared dream, a wacky time-traveling adventure!

Students entering grades 1-12 can join this FREE summer program at the Capitol Civic Centre. Dive into a week of exciting rehearsals from July 28th to August 1st, 1:00 PM – 5:15 PM daily, culminating in two public performances on Saturday, August 2nd at 11:00 AM and 2:00 PM.

Left behind while their friends embark on summer adventures, Hank and Gretchen are stuck with a severe case of the summertime blues. But boredom quickly morphs into bewilderment when they drift into a shared dream, a wacky time-traveling adventure! Suddenly, they’re Hansel and Gretel, lost in a hilariously spooky forest. Enter Granny, a wise-cracking guide who’s seen it all, and a cast of quirky characters: mischievous Rascals who love a good prank, adorable Wallybirds with a serious cookie addiction, and a legion of gingerbread men with questionable baking skills. But the real mystery lies in the candy-coated cottage and its resident, the infamous Wildwood Witch. Is she a cackling villain or a misunderstood baker with a serious sweet tooth? Get ready for a musical romp filled with laughter, thrills, and a touch of the bizarre as Hank and Gretchen navigate their dream, learning that maybe, just maybe, the greatest adventures happen when you least expect them.
